Feature based surface builder is a feature that puts together a collection of blocks that serve to add variety and decoration to the Overworld surface. This tutorial will explain what is needed to create this feature, including size, frequency, generation location, and more!

- `iterations` determine how many blocks will be placed. I'm going to use the Molang `math.random_integer` function to randomize the number of blocks. In this case, it'll be 20 to 25 blocks.
|
||||
- `iterations` 决定将放置的方块数量。使用Molang的 `math.random_integer` 函数可实现数量随机化。本示例中将在20到25个方块之间随机
|
||||
|
||||
- `extent` use an array to determine the size of the blob. `[0, 8]` means the size is extended from 0 to 8 blocks. So, our blob would be 8 blocks long both on X and Z axis. **Only use this for X and Z distribution**.
|
||||
- `extent` 使用数组决定斑块尺寸。`[0, 8]` 表示斑块从0到8格扩展。因此,我们的斑块在X和Z轴上将延伸8格。**该参数仅适用于X和Z轴分布**
|
||||
|
||||
- `"y": "q.heightmap(v.worldx, v.worldz) -1` means it will put the block on the highest block on the y coordinate -1. So it'll always put the feature on the surface.
|
||||
- `"y": "q.heightmap(v.worldx, v.worldz) -1` 表示方块将放置于当前地表最高点的Y坐标-1处,即始终在地表生成
|
||||
|
||||
- `distribution` specifies the type of distribution to use. Available include `Gaussian`, `Inverse Gaussian`, `Uniform`,`Fixed Grid` and `Jittered Grid`
|
||||
- `distribution` 指定分布类型。可用选项包括:`Gaussian`(高斯分布)、`Inverse Gaussian`(逆高斯分布)、`Uniform`(均匀分布)、`Fixed Grid`(固定网格)和`Jittered Grid`(抖动网格)
